Design Open Houses for Reimagine Hollins and Oak Grove

Posted on April 27, 2018 at 11:43 AM by Bailey Howard-DuBois

Design Open House

You told us how Oak Grove could become a new destination to EAT. SHOP. ENTERTAIN. CONNECT. all within a short, comfortable walk, and that Hollins could become an even better place to LEARN. WORK. DINE. PLAY. 

See where these ideas could lead at Design Open Houses for the Oak Grove and the Hollins Center studies this month! We will present the full results of the survey (595 completed for Oak Grove and 393 completed for Hollins) and our public input exercises. You’ll get a chance to weigh in on more specific future possibilities for the area regarding transportation, community spaces, design and aesthetics.

The meetings are family friendly and will include fun activities for the kids to learn about planning their community! CORTRAN and STAR service will be available.
